murine
English Thesaurus
1. a rodent that is a member of the family Muridae (noun.animal)
| hypernym | : | gnawer, rodent, |
| definition | : | relatively small placental mammals having a single pair of constantly growing incisor teeth specialized for gnawing (noun.animal) |
| derivation | : | murine, |
| definition | : | of or relating to or transmitted by a member of the family Muridae (rats and mice) (adj.pert) |
2. of or relating to or transmitted by a member of the family Muridae (rats and mice) (adj.pert)
| pertainym | : | family muridae, muridae, |
| definition | : | originally Old World rats now distributed worldwide; distinguished from the Cricetidae by typically lacking cheek pouches (noun.animal) |
| derivation | : | murine, |
| definition | : | a rodent that is a member of the family Muridae (noun.animal) |
